Implement a complete investor access system for the pitch deck:

- Passwordless magic link auth (jose JWT + nodemailer SMTP)
- Per-investor audit logging (slide views, assumption changes, chat)
- Financial model snapshot persistence (auto-save/restore per investor)
- PWA support (manifest, service worker, offline caching, icons)
- Security safeguards (watermark overlay, rate limiting, anti-scraping
  headers, content protection, single-session enforcement)
- Admin API for invite/revoke/audit-log management
- Integrated into docker-compose.coolify.yml for production deployment
